So how many Civil War battles were there?

The simple answer is, there were a lot of them. In fact there were hundreds. Of course these were not all Gettysburg size encounters.

Some of the battles of the Civil War were very small and most people probably never heard of most of them, but they are interesting nonetheless.

There were literally hundreds of battles fought throughout the war. Civil War casualties were very low in these battles and they did not involve very many soldiers.

For this reason they are not as well-known as the more famous battles of the Civil War such as Bull Run, Gettysburg, Antietam, Chancellorsville, Vicksburg, The Wilderness, Jonesboro, or New Orleans.
